Lusaka Contemporary Dining Room Table A dining area is a room for consuming food. Today most commonly it is adjacent to the kitchen for convenience in serving, although in medieval times it was often on an totally different floor level. Historically the dining room is furnished with a big dining table and a number of dining chairs rather; the most frequent shape is normally rectangular with two armed end chairs and an even amount of un-armed side chairs over the long sides.In the Middle Ages, upper class Britons and other Western european nobility in castles or large manor homes dined in the fantastic hall. This was a sizable multi-function room capable of seating the bulk of the population of the house. The family would sit at the top table on a raised dais, with the rest of the population arrayed in order of diminishing rank from them. Furniture in the fantastic hall would have a tendency to be long trestle furniture with benches. The sheer number of people in a Great Hall meant it could probably experienced a active, bustling atmosphere.Recommendations that it could likewise have been quite smelly and smoky are most likely, by the requirements of the time, unfounded. These rooms possessed large chimneys and high ceilings and there is a free flow of air through the many door and screen openings.It really is true that the owners of such properties started to develop a taste for more personal gatherings in smaller 'parlers' or 'privee parlers' off the key hall but this is regarded as due just as much to political and social changes regarding the increased comfort afforded by such rooms. In the beginning, the Black Death that ravaged European countries in the 14th Hundred years caused a scarcity of labour which had resulted in a malfunction in the feudal system. Also the religious persecutions following a dissolution of the monasteries under Henry VIII managed to get unwise to talk freely before large numbers of people.As time passes, the nobility took more of their meals in the parlour, and the parlour became, functionally, a dining room (or was put into two distinct rooms). It migrated farther from the fantastic Hall also, often utilized via grand ceremonial staircases from the dais in the fantastic Hall. Eventually dining in the fantastic Hall became something that was done primarily on special situations.Toward the start of the 18th Century, a pattern surfaced where the women of the home would withdraw after meal from the dining area to the pulling room. The gentlemen would remain in the dining room having drinks. The dining area tended to take on a more masculine tenor as a result.A typical UNITED STATES dining room will contain a table with chairs arranged over the factors and ends of the table, and also other furniture pieces, (often used for keeping formal china), as space permits. Often desks in modern kitchen rooms will have a removable leaf to permit for the bigger number of folks present on those special events without taking up extra space when not in use. Although the "typical" family dining experience is at a wooden stand or some kind of kitchen area, some choose to make their dining rooms more comfortable by using couches or comfortable recliners.In modern Canadian and American homes, the dining area is adjacent to the living room typically, being progressively more used limited to formal kitchen with friends or on special events. For casual daily dishes, most medium size homes and larger will have a space adjacent to the kitchen where stand and chair can be inserted, larger spaces tend to be known as a dinette while an inferior one is called a breakfast nook. Smaller properties and condos may instead have a breakfast club, often of an different elevation than the standard kitchen counter (either raised for stools or decreased for recliners). If the home lacks a dinette, breakfast nook, or breakfast bar, then the kitchen or family room will be used for day-to-day eating.This is typically the situation in Britain, where the dining room would for many families be utilized only on Sundays, other dishes being consumed in your kitchen.In Australia, the utilization of a dining room is still common, yet no essential part of modern home design. For most, it is considered a space to be used during formal celebrations or occasions. Smaller homes, akin to the USA and Canada, use a breakfast table or bar positioned within the confines of a kitchen or living space for meals.
